Final answer:

The brachiocephalic trunk, left common carotid artery, and left subclavian artery are the three arteries that branch directly off the aortic arch. They supply blood to the upper body, including head, neck, and arms. The brachiocephalic trunk further divides into the right subclavian artery and the right common carotid artery.

The arteries that branch directly off the aortic arch are the brachiocephalic trunk, the left common carotid artery, and the left subclavian artery.

The aortic arch is the portion of the main artery that bends between the ascending and descending aorta. The three primary elastic arteries stemming from it are essential for supplying blood to the upper parts of the body, including the head, neck, and arms. The brachiocephalic artery is unique to the right side of the body; it divides into the right subclavian artery, responsible for blood supply to the right arm, shoulder, and neck, and the right common carotid artery, which further branches into the external and internal carotid arteries supplying the right side of the head and neck. The left subclavian artery arises independently from the aortic arch and has a similar role to its right counterpart on the left side of the body. The left common carotid artery also arises directly from the aortic arch and supplies the left side of head and neck. These arteries play a vital role in systemic circulation and are classified as elastic arteries due to their ability to stretch and recoil, maintaining continuous blood flow despite the pulsatile nature of the heartbeat.
